## GitHub Search Scraper — Repos, Users & Issues

**Search all of GitHub and get clean, structured rows — repositories, users, issues/PRs or code — plus full repo detail lookups by `owner/name`.** Built on GitHub's official REST API with rate-limit backoff. Add a free personal access token to run reliably at 5,000 req/h.

Perfect for developer lead-gen, open-source market research, star/trend tracking, dependency analysis, or feeding a dataset.

### What you get

Output depends on `searchType` (or the `repos` lookup):

- **Repositories** — `fullName`, `owner`, `description`, `url`, `homepage`, `language`, `stars`, `forks`, `watchers`, `openIssues`, `topics`, `license` (SPDX), `isFork`, `archived`, `defaultBranch`, `createdAt`, `updatedAt`, `pushedAt`
- **Users** — `login`, `url`, `userType`, `name`, `company`, `blog`, `location`, `bio`, `publicRepos`, `followers`, `following`
- **Issues / PRs** — `number`, `title`, `url`, `state`, `user`, `labels`, `comments`, `createdAt`, `updatedAt`, `closedAt`, `body` (a `type` of `issue` or `pull_request`)
- **Code** — `name`, `path`, `repository`, `url`, `sha`

Every row carries a `type` field so mixed exports stay unambiguous.

### Modes

- **Search** — pass a `query` in GitHub search syntax and choose `searchType` (`repositories`, `users`, `issues`, `code`). Sort and order supported. GitHub caps search itself at 1,000 results.
- **Repo detail** — pass `repos` (e.g. `["facebook/react"]`) to fetch full repository objects directly, no search needed.

### Input

| Field | Type | Default | Description |
|-------|------|---------|-------------|
| `searchType` | string | `repositories` | `repositories`, `users`, `issues`, `code` |
| `query` | string | — | GitHub search syntax, e.g. `stars:>10000 language:rust` |
| `sort` | string | best match | Repos: `stars`/`forks`/`updated`. Users: `followers`/`repositories`/`joined`. Issues: `created`/`updated`/`comments` |
| `order` | string | `desc` | `desc` or `asc` |
| `repos` | array | — | Fetch specific repos by `owner/name` |
| `token` | string (secret) | — | GitHub PAT → 5,000 req/h (read-only `public_repo` scope is enough) |
| `maxResults` | integer | `100` | Cap on results (GitHub search maxes at 1,000) |

Provide at least one of `query` or `repos`.

### Example input

```json
{
  "searchType": "repositories",
  "query": "stars:>50000 language:typescript",
  "sort": "stars",
  "maxResults": 100
}
```

Devs in a city (lead-gen):

```json
{
  "searchType": "users",
  "query": "location:berlin followers:>500",
  "sort": "followers",
  "maxResults": 50
}
```

### Notes

- **Token (recommended, BYO):** without a token GitHub limits unauthenticated use to ~10 search req/min and lower per-hour caps — fine for small runs, unreliable at scale. A read-only PAT (`public_repo` scope) lifts you to 5,000 req/h. It's stored as a secret. The actor still runs keyless; it just warns and may throttle.
- GitHub search returns at most 1,000 results per query regardless of `maxResults` — narrow the query to page deeper.
